What is RTP and Why is It Important?
Return to Player (RTP) is a critical metric that indicates the percentage of wagered money a game is expected to return to players over time. For instance, a game with an RTP of 96% theoretically returns £96 for every £100 wagered. In practical terms, this means:
- The higher the RTP, the better your chances of winning back your stake.
- Games with an RTP below 95% are generally considered less favourable.

What Should I Look for in Bonus Terms?
New games often come with promotional bonuses, but these bonuses can vary widely in their terms. Here are key factors to consider:
- Bonus Amount: Is it a percentage match or a fixed amount?
- Eligible Games: Ensure the new games qualify for the bonus.
- Expiry Dates: Bonuses may come with timers; be cautious of these.
- Max Cashout: Some bonuses have caps on how much you can withdraw.
For example, if you receive a 100% bonus up to £200 on a new slot with a 35x wagering requirement, you must wager £7,000 (£200 x 35) before you can withdraw any winnings. Understanding these terms can help you maximise your potential returns.
What are Wagering Requirements?
Wagering requirements indicate how many times you must wager your bonus before you can cash out. A typical requirement might be 30x to 40x the bonus amount. Here’s how it works:
- If you receive a £100 bonus with a 40x requirement, you must wager £4,000 (£100 x 40) before being able to withdraw any funds.
- Always check if the new game contributes fully to the wagering requirement. Many games only contribute a percentage, usually between 50% to 100%.

Common Myths about New Game Releases
Understanding the facts versus the myths can save you time and money. Here are some common misconceptions:
- Myth: New games always have lower RTPs.
- Fact: Many new games feature competitive RTPs, often designed to attract players.
- Myth: Bonuses are free money.
- Fact: Bonuses come with terms that require careful consideration, including wagering requirements.
- Myth: All games contribute equally to wagering requirements.
- Fact: Check each game’s contribution percentage; it varies significantly.
